package main
import "github.com/visualfc/goqt/ui"
type TableRow struct {
items *[cols]*ui.QTableWidgetItem
bar *ui.QProgressBar
seg *seginfo
}
type Table struct {
*ui.QTableWidget
rows map[[16]byte]*TableRow
}
func NewTable() *Table {
return &Table{ui.NewTableWidget(), make(map[[16]byte]*TableRow)}
}
func NewTableRow() *TableRow {
var items [cols]*ui.QTableWidgetItem
for i, _ := range items {
items[i] = ui.NewTableWidgetItem()
if i > 0 {
items[i].SetTextAlignment(0x82) // center right
}
}
bar := ui.NewProgressBar()
return &TableRow{&items, bar, nil}
}
func (t *Table) AppendRow(row *TableRow) int32 {
n := t.RowCount()
t.InsertRow(n)
t.SetItem(n, 0, row.items[0])
t.SetItem(n, 1, row.items[1])
t.SetItem(n, 2, row.items[2])
//row.bar.SetFormat("%p%, %v/%m")
t.SetCellWidget(n, 3, row.bar)
t.SetItem(n, 4, row.items[3])
t.SetItem(n, 5, row.items[4])
return n
}
func (t *Table) DeleteRow(id [16]byte) {
i := t.rows[id].items[0].Row()
for j, _ := range t.rows[id].items {
t.RemoveCellWidget(i, int32(j))
}
t.rows[id].bar.Delete()
for _, item := range t.rows[id].items {
item.Delete()
}
delete(t.rows, id)
t.RemoveRow(i)
}
func (t *Table) Refresh(seg *seginfo, delrow bool) {
var row *TableRow
row, ok := t.rows[seg.sid]
if !ok {
row = NewTableRow()
t.rows[seg.sid] = row
row.seg = seg
t.AppendRow(row)
row.items[0].SetText(seg.name)
row.items[1].SetText(seg.site)
}
row.items[2].SetText(seg.size.String())
row.items[3].SetText(seg.speed.String())
row.items[4].SetText(seg.eta)
if seg.status == ERROR {
row.bar.SetMaximum(100)
color := ui.NewColor()
color.SetRed(180)
p := row.bar.Palette()
p.SetColorWithCrColor(ui.QPalette_Base, color)
row.bar.SetPalette(p)
} else if seg.size >= 0 {
row.bar.SetMaximum(int32(seg.size))
}
if seg.size > 0 {
row.bar.SetValue(int32(seg.down))
if seg.status != DONE {
color := ui.NewColor()
color.SetGreen(180)
p := row.bar.Palette()
p.SetColorWithCrColor(ui.QPalette_Highlight, color)
row.bar.SetPalette(p)
}
}
t.ResizeColumnsToContents()
if delrow {
t.DeleteRow(row.seg.sid)
}
}
